Ingredients:


๐Ÿงˆย 2 tablespoons butter
๐Ÿ„ย 1 pound mushrooms, sliced
๐Ÿงˆย 1 tablespoon butter
๐Ÿง…ย 1 onion, diced
๐Ÿฅ•ย 2 carrots, diced
๐ŸŒฟย 2 stalks celery, diced
๐Ÿง„ย 2 cloves garlic, chopped
๐ŸŒฑย 1 teaspoon thyme, chopped
๐Ÿ—ย 6 cups chicken broth
๐ŸŒพย 1 cup wild rice (or a blend of rice including wild rice)
๐Ÿ—ย 1 1/2 cups chicken, cooked and diced or shredded
๐Ÿฅ›ย 1 cup milk or cream
๐Ÿง€ย 1 cup parmigiano reggiano (parmesan), grated
๐Ÿง‚ย salt and pepper to taste


directions:


1. Melt the butter in a pan over medium-high heat, add the mushrooms and cook
until the mushrooms have released their liquids and the liquid has evaporated,
about 10-15 minutes, before setting aside.
2. Melt the butter in the pan, add the onions, carrots and celery and cook until tender,
about 8-10 minutes.
3. Mix in the garlic and thyme and cook until fragrant, about a minute.
4. Add the broth, rice, chicken and mushrooms, bring to a boil, reduce the heat and
simmer, covered, until the rice is tender, about 20-30 minutes.
5. Mix in the milk and cheese and cook until the cheese has melted before seasoning
with salt and pepper to taste.
